Transaction 103ca3d66b96ff50e1aa21b9c6a90d73fbcba75710c9ab42eeb0ced73f6ad853

5 Input
2 Outputs
  • 103ca3d66b96ff50e1aa21b9c6a90d73fbcba75710c9ab42eeb0ced73f6ad853:0
  • value  18786433
    address  1F4Xf1m59BCvWdpyCgZ8QgiY3Fn6rHgYN
  • 103ca3d66b96ff50e1aa21b9c6a90d73fbcba75710c9ab42eeb0ced73f6ad853:1
  • value  233008
    address  bc1qlg660jz8dx9xtnpgrlfzt0n0cv6qwflaawzht5